Abstract
An assembly type energy-saving house profile is of a profile structure with a triangular section. The profile comprises plates, splicing pipes, connection plates and edge closing frames. Frames on the peripheries of the plates are the edge closing frames, a triangular notch is formed in the section of each edge closing frame, upper and lower splicing pipes can be inserted into the triangular notches, the sections between the two adjacent boards form a rhombic notch, the splicing pipes can be inserted into the rhombic notch, and the connection plates can be inserted into splicing elements to serve as connectors. By means of the profile, connection between wallboards becomes firmer and more stable, and the joint of the wallboards also has excellent windproof and heat-insulation properties due to the application of a bridge-cutoff structure. The profile is of a special universal male and female joint structure, and meets different requirements in different construction places.
